Spendee
Spendee

Description: Spendee is a user-friendly budgeting and expense tracking app available on iOS, Android, Mac, Windows and as a web app. It allows users to easily create budgets, categorize expenses, track spending habits over time and stay on top of finances through automatic bank imports, notifications and reporting.
